Key Medical Applications
- Respiratory Tract Infections (pneumonia, bronchitis, sinusitis, pharyngitis)
- Urinary Tract Infections (UTIs)
- Meningitis (esp. Listeria monocytogenes, Group B strep)
- Septicemia & Bacteremia
- Bacterial Endocarditis Prophylaxis (before dental/surgical procedures)
- Skin & Soft Tissue Infections
- Intra-abdominal and GI Infections (enteritis, peritonitis, Salmonella, Shigella, E. coli)
- Bone & Joint Infections

Frequently Asked Questions
What is ampicillin used for? Respiratory, urinary, skin, gastrointestinal, meningitis, sepsis, and endocarditis infections caused by susceptible bacteria.
How quickly does ampicillin work? Symptoms usually improve within 24–48 hours. Complete the full prescribed course even if you feel better.
Is ampicillin safe for children and infants? Yes—dosing guidelines are established for pediatric and neonatal use.
Can I use ampicillin for a viral infection? No—ampicillin only treats bacterial infections, not viruses like the flu or common cold.
